Vivus Review: A Cutting-Edge Digital Transformation Partner

Introduction

Vivus is a California-based technology company specializing in digital transformation services for startups and established businesses. Their expertise spans brand identity, software development (web and mobile), UI/UX design, and MVP development, utilizing modern tech stacks like Python, React, Swift, and Flutter. Clients praise Vivus for their agile approach, high-quality deliverables, and personalized attention, making them a go-to partner for businesses looking to innovate.
